#1 Apple Wooed By Arizona As Obama Seeks U.S. Jobs Comeback
  Arizona got snubbed by Apple in 2012 when the iPhone maker picked Texas to build a new operations hub. Scott Smith, the mayor of the Phoenix suburb of Mesa, was determined to keep history from  repeating itself. (Bloomberg)
Why This Is Important:  The town provided major incentives to entice Apple its way, including tax breaks and speedier building permits. It even got the state to declare a vacant 1.3 million-square-foot facility, that Apple showed interest in, a foreign trade zone.

#2 Sony Makes Big Profits, Just Not On Electronics
  Not all companies with Sony in the name are toxic. Take Sony Financial, the insurer in which Sony owns a 60 percent stake. While the parent company said last week that it expects to lose $1.1 billion for the 2013-14 fiscal year, Sony Financial is doing just fine, thanks. (Businessweek)
Why This Is Important: Although Sony is exiting PCs and creating a separate TV business subsidiary, impatient analysts are criticizing Hirai's lack of a growth strategy.

#3 Meet The Next Small Windows Tablet: Asus VivoTab Note 8
  Announced at January's Consumer Electronics Show, the Asus VivoTab Note 8 tablet is now available for sale. The original price was slated to be $299, but the Windows 8.1 tablet launched on Microsoft's online store for $329 on Monday, notes Engadget. Just hours after its initial availability, the VivoTab Note 8 shows as "out of stock" in the Microsoft Store. (TechNewsWorld)
Why This Is Important: The device is $30 more than it was originally expected to be priced, making it nearly $100 more than similarly featured tablets -- a bold move for a crowded market.
